Arrow Rally Update - Early Planning States

Here's a little bit of planning update for you folks .....

Wednesday is our normal off-site day and we are working along those lines to provide the attendees with a single solution entertainment venue. Once we figure out all the details, when you enter your purchase preferences in the Registration OnLine Software, there will be a single purchase option for an "Evening In Las Vegas." Your evening in Las Vegas will include round trip transportation to and from the venue. This becomes more important in the evening after the show. I personally would prefer to sit back and relax rather than drive through the NV desert after dark.

The "coach" will drop us off in close proximity to the venue and you will be invited to join the line at an excellent buffet type dinner. I am told that Vegas buffets in upscale hotels (Yes we are going there) will be awesome.

After a 1 hour meal period, we are going for a 7:00pm show. The 'show" is a major headliner and I'm sure that it will be well received. At some point near ~9:00pm we will begin boarding the coach for the return trip.

Our ETA to Nevada Treasure will be close to 10:00pm.

I remember LV as being heavily subsidized in favor of visitors however the worm has turned.

Considering that this is going to be in downtown Las Vegas, as stress free as possible, featuring deluxe transportation, outstanding meal and a headliner show, we are targeting a per person price in the range of 150.00 to 200.00 which I am told is cheap. Our coordinator told me that a recent 4 person meal that he recently experienced ran nearly 1200.00. Oh! Don't forget about parking when available close to where you want to be plus the cost.

On Thursday "or" Friday we are pulling the strings on a National Park / Monument activity since those will give the biggest bang for the buck. These I expect will be car pooled, lunch if possible, with plenty of time to enjoy the venue/scenery. Some of our folks, I'm sure will be making Bee Lines back into town to begin their campaign in defeat of a number of 1 armed bandits. That of course is up to the individual couples.

It's still very early in the planning stages however we do have boots on the ground and they are helping to develop the best venues at the best possible prices keeping in mind the amount of time away from the resort. Most of us have puppies.

I am getting more & more excited about this event regardless of the fact that I'll be approximately 2400.00 miles for us.
